概括
识别蛋白质热点,蛋白质与蛋白质相互作用中的关键残留物,对于理解复杂稳定性和开发疗法至关重要. 包括分子动力学和机器学习在内的计算方法正在推进热点分析.
科学领域:
- 生物化学和生物物理学
- 计算生物学 计算生物学
- 结构生物学 结构生物学
背景情况:
- 蛋白与蛋白相互作用 (PPI) 是细胞过程的基础.
- 一小部分残留物,称为热点,对蛋白质复合体的结合能量和稳定性有显著的贡献.
- 准确识别热点对于理解PPI和设计有针对性的治疗来说至关重要.
研究的目的:
- 审查最近计算方法的进展,以识别蛋白质-蛋白质接口的热点.
- 讨论热点预测当前的挑战和未来的方向.
- 强调结合分子动力学模拟和机器学习方法的协同潜力.
主要方法:
- 关于分析蛋白质-蛋白质接口的分子动力学 (MD) 模拟的文献综述.
- 基于机器学习 (ML) 的预测器的分析,用于热点识别.
- 讨论实验技术,如氨酸扫描及其局限性.
主要成果:
- 分子动力学模拟为蛋白质接口的动态和能量景观提供了洞察力.
- 机器学习模型在越来越准确地预测热点方面显示出前景.
- 当前的计算方法在处理大型和动态的蛋白质系统时面临着挑战.
结论:
- 结合分子动力学和机器学习,为热点预测提供了一个强大的框架.
- 这种综合方法可以捕捉蛋白质接口的动态和能量复杂性.
- 增强的热点预测将改善我们对PPI的理解,并促进治疗开发.

Many proteins form complexes to carry out their functions, making protein-protein interactions (PPIs) essential for an organism's survival. Most PPIs are stabilized by numerous weak noncovalent chemical forces. The physical shape of the interfaces determines the way two proteins interact. An organism can have thousands of different proteins, and these proteins must cooperate to ensure the health of an organism. Proteins bind to other proteins and form complexes to carry out their functions. Many proteins interact with multiple other proteins creating a complex network of protein interactions.

Many proteins’ biological role depends on their interactions with their ligands, small molecules that bind to specific locations on the protein known as ligand-binding sites. Ligand-binding sites are often conserved among homologous proteins as these sites are critical for protein function.
